One of the largest dairy-to-manure-to-renewable-natural-gas facilities in the country is now complete in Brown County. Dynamic Renewables held a ribbon-cutting ceremony Thursday at its new 16-unit anaerobic digestion facility on Mill Road in the town of Wrightstown. Read more…
U.S. Department of Agriculture (USDA) Rural Development State Director for Wisconsin Julie Lassa today joined representatives of Dynamic Renewables, Miron Construction, Live Oak Bank and others at a ribbon cutting to celebrate completion of BC Organics, a new anaerobic digester in Brown County. Miron Construction Co., Inc., in partnership with Somerville, Inc., recently broke ground on the Brown County STEM Innovation Center on the University of Wisconsin – Green Bay campus. Miron serves as the general contractor of the new $12 million, 65,000-square-foot education center. The purpose […] Read more
